1. Brush and Floss Every Day
Good oral hygiene is the key to a beautiful smile. Brushing your teeth at least twice a day helps remove food particles and plaque that can cause cavities. Use a soft-bristle toothbrush and fluoride toothpaste for the best results.
Don’t forget to floss daily as well. Flossing cleans the spaces between your teeth where a toothbrush can’t reach. This helps prevent gum disease and bad breath. Keeping up with daily brushing and flossing will help maintain a clean and healthy smile.
2. Eat Healthy Foods for Strong Teeth
Your diet plays a big role in your dental health. Eating too much sugar can lead to cavities and tooth decay. Instead, choose foods that are good for your teeth, such as dairy products, leafy greens, and crunchy fruits and vegetables.
Drinking plenty of water is also important. Water washes away food particles and keeps your mouth hydrated. Try to avoid soda and sugary drinks, as they can weaken your tooth enamel and cause stains.

5. Visit Your Dentist Regularly
Regular dental check-ups are important for keeping your smile healthy. Your dentist can check for cavities, gum disease, and other problems before they get worse. Professional cleanings remove plaque and tartar that brushing alone cannot get rid of.
It is recommended to visit your dentist at least twice a year. If you have any dental concerns, do not wait—get them checked early. Taking care of small issues now can prevent bigger problems in the future.
